I found that using aerodynamic simulation tools, like ANSYS, can really help balance that accuracy and efficiency you mentioned. For instance, taking time to set up detailed boundary conditions upfront can save hours later by avoiding recalculations. Just a thought: don’t underestimate the power of quick iterative drafts too; they often spark better ideas down the road.
